jpg和jpeg有什么区别

JPG和JPEG其实是一个东西

JPEG是JPG的全名、正式扩展名。但因DOS、Windows 95等早期系统采用的8.3命名规则只支持最长3字符的扩展名,为了兼容采用了.jpg。也因历史习惯和兼容性考虑,.jpg目前更流行。

其他常用的扩展名还包括.jpeg、.jpe、.jfif以及.jif。

知识补充:

在电脑中,JPEG(发音为jay-peg, IPA:[ˈdʒeɪpɛg])是一种针对相片图像而广泛使用的一种有损压缩标准方法。这个名称代表Joint Photographic Experts Group(联合图像专家小组)。此团队创立于西元1986年,1992年发布了JPEG的标准而在1994年获得了ISO 10918-1的认定。JPEG与视频音频压缩标准的MPEG(Moving Picture Experts Group)很容易混淆,但两者是不同的组织及标准。

JPEG本身只有描述如何将一个图像转换为字节的数据流(streaming),但并没有说明这些字节如何在任何特定的存储媒体上被封存起来。JPEG的压缩方式通常是破坏性数据压缩(lossy compression),意即在压缩过程中图像的质量会遭受到可见的破坏,有一种以JPEG为基础的标准Lossless JPEG是采用无损的压缩方式,但Lossless JPEG并没有受到广泛的支持。

更多相关知识,请关注PHP中文网!!

php jpeg windows,jpg和jpeg有什么区别相关推荐

  1. JPEG原理分析及JPEG解码器的调试

    一.JPEG编码原理 1.将RGB转换为YUV空间.(相关性较小) 2.零偏置.(使最大的绝对值大的无符号数变为绝对值小的有符号数,减小数据平均的位数,例如0~255变为-128~127) 3.做8* ...

  2. php添加jpeg,PHP-如何将JPEG图像保存为渐进JPEG?

    我具有以下将JPEG保存为渐进JPEG的功能.它已保存,但不是渐进式JPEG.这个对吗 ? function save($filename, $image_type = IMAGETYPE_JPEG, ...

  3. 【数据压缩-实验5】JPEG原理分析及JPEG解码器的调试

    目录 JEPG原理 简述 优点 缺点 JPEG文件格式 常用标记码 编解码原理 编码原理 Level offset-零偏置 DCT变换 量化 DC系数差分编码 AC系数的之字形扫描+游程编码 解码原理 ...

  4. JPEG原理分析 及 JPEG解码器的调试

    文章目录 数据压缩实验(五) 一.JPEG原理分析 1.概述 优点 缺点 2.JPEG编解码原理 (1)彩色空间 (2)Level offset--零偏置电平下移 (3)8x8 DCT--离散余弦变换 ...

  5. JPEG原理分析及JPEG解码器的解析

    文章目录 JPEG原理分析及JPEG解码器的调试 原理分析 JPEG编解码流程图 DC系数编码 AC系数编码 JPEG文件格式 Segment组织形式 JPEG 的 Segment Marker no ...

  6. 【数据压缩】实验:JPEG原理分析及JPEG解码器的调试

    一.JPEG编解码原理 1.1 JPEG图像压缩标准基本介绍 JPEG是Joint Photographic Experts Group(联合图像专家小组)的缩写,文件后缀名为.jpg或.jpeg,是 ...

  7. jpg图片与jpeg图片格式的区别(没有区别,.jpg只是扩展名.jpeg的缩写)JPEG图像压缩(YUV4:2:0 缩减采样、缩减取样)(离散余弦变换 DCT算法)(量化)(熵编码)(霍夫曼哈夫曼)

    文章目录 20191026 20220414 更新,更系统去了解里面的编码压缩流程 科普:关于图像格式JPG和JPEG你知多少? 一.前言 二.JPEG和JPG的关系 三.色彩空间转换 缩减取样 离散 ...

  8. Linux中要重启apache服务与在windows是有很大的区别,下面我们来介绍一下

    在Linux中要重启apache服务与在windows是有很大的区别,下面我们来介绍一下常用的命令,需要的朋友参考下吧(http://www.hnkjlb.com) linux系统为Ubuntu 一. ...

  9. Linux虚拟主机与Windows虚拟主机之间有什么区别

    我们知道,在购买主机时,根据我们的需求来选择虚拟主机.独立主机或者VPS云主机.或者为了免除备案的麻烦,选择美国虚拟主机.香港虚拟主机或者其他海外主机.但往往会忽略了Linux虚拟主机与Windows ...

  10. 【操作系统】Linux内核和Windows系统的内核有什么区别?

    本文内容转载自"拉勾教育"的讲义,更多课程信息请关注拉勾教育.本人在学习之余记记笔记,顺便当当搬运工! 目录 Linux内核和Windows系统的内核有什么区别? 什么是内核? 内 ...

最新文章

  1. 循环神经网络(RNN, Recurrent Neural Networks)——无非引入了环,解决时间序列问题...
  2. 我要人人都看到我,但不知道我是谁
  3. CCNA配置试验之七 PPP中PAP和CHAP的验证
  4. 碧桂园博智林机器人总部大楼_碧桂园职院新规划曝光!将建机器人实训大楼、新宿舍、水幕电影等...
  5. 优集品 php,从细节处着眼 优集品打造成人世界的儿童节
  6. linux svn 看不到文件,SVN更新时不能打开新文件svn-base系统找不到指定的文件
  7. java treemap_Java TreeMap lastEntry()方法与示例
  8. MATLAB图像处理之二值化以及灰度处理
  9. 自定义Android TabHost的背景及文字
  10. 2017 4月26日上午
  11. TwinCAT3入门教程4-伺服常用功能程序实现
  12. 软件无线电实验 matlab,基于MATLAB和ModelSim的软件无线电课程实验设计
  13. 什么是token/token如何使用
  14. vue + elment ui打印表格数据
  15. 如何更新neovim以及安装指定版本
  16. 超乎认知 认知智能十大黑科技 我国首次对外公布 道翰天琼认知智能
  17. 空腹不能吃的东西,可不仅仅是香蕉和柿子
  18. PlayMaker之开发案例
  19. 网络编程 -java高级技术
  20. Linux系统常见错误***error*** (zip#Write) sorry, your system doesn t appear to have the zip pgm

热门文章

  1. wpf-折线图绘制2-oxyplot-3-修饰图像(注释)
  2. 如何修改echarts源码(其他框架也可适用)
  3. PLM与ERP的区别
  4. 程序员叫啥名字_网友:什么是好程序员?腾讯员工:首先起个“配”自己的网名!...
  5. mammothJs解析docx文件
  6. 职场004: 开放心态的意义
  7. JavaScript之切换背景图片(并使)背景栏保持和背景色调相似
  8. android nfc P2P模式
  9. 利用audacity分析浊音、清音与爆破音的信号特性
  10. Linux 合并两个文件